    33" Mono ?

    Have a 33" Mono Delta Force Type. What Motor, ESC, and prop will easily get me in the 40s range. Have already fried 2 SV-27 Motors and a ESC that came with it.

    a budget setup of with a feigao 9xl on 4s with a x640 prop should see you in the 40s fairly easily.
    or for a few more dollars o.s.e has the leopard motors possibly the 2000kv

                my exsperiance with the DF 33 is that a 642 is to small to get it out of the water (with a 13XL)
                my best setup with the 13XL was a x645 done by eggneg (thats the setup on the vid)

                with the 642 it is easely 10 mph slower and i cant get it to run "dry" no matter were i put the CG.

                    yes i did.
                    my best setup with mine is rino 4900 3S X 2 for 22.2V
                    if memmory serves i used to get 5-6 minutes from that setup without any heat to speak of and without LWC kicking in
